The Assistant/Associate Dean for Strategic Technology Initiatives provides vision and leadership to effectively integrate technology
into the operations of Milner Library. The Associate Dean develops and implements processes aligned with the university’s strategic plan and student and faculty needs. The Associate Dean provides direction for Milner Library’s technology departments, and coordinates the technology planning of services with Library departments and units. The Associate Dean will collaborate with university technology leadership and the university community to shape and implement information technology initiatives according to the needs of Educating Illinois.

Applicants should have a minimum of five years of progressively responsible experience developing and implementing library
service-oriented technologies (three years preferably in a leadership capacity). A Master’s degree from an ALA accredited graduate program and an additional advanced degree are required at time of hire.

The Clinical Librarian/Informationist will support the clinical programs in the College of Health Professions at the University of Akron, which includes the School of Nursing, the School of Nutrition/Dietetics, the School of Social Work, the School of Speech-Language Pathology and Audiology, and the Child Life Specialist Program. The Clinical Librarian/Informationist will create and implement faculty development and inter-professional development programs in the College of Health Professions. Collaborating with faculty from the College, the librarian will develop and support modules utilizing multiple media formats and mobile technologies to instruct students in the process of implementing evidence-based practice in the clinical setting. These modules will be course-integrated and will build upon each other beginning with the sophomore year and moving through the academic career. The Clinical Librarian/Informationist will primarily work outside the Science & Technology Library in clinical and classroom settings and will build strong collaborative relationships with faculty in the College of Health Professions. This is a tenure-track position; therefore the successful candidate will be required to meet the University of Akron Libraries’ criteria for promotion and tenure, which include conducting research, teaching, participating on library and university committees, and serving in professional organizations.

BASIC FUNCTION

This hands-on role supports advanced platform product initiatives for the AMC, IFC, SUNDANCE, WE tv, AMC/Sundance Channel Global and their associated products.

The Analyst, Advanced Platform Distribution will coordinate the meta data and non-video assets for the syndication of Advanced Platform content to all affiliates across all distribution methods including Digital Set Top Box (DSTB) On Demand, TV Everywhere (TVE), Mobile, EST (Electronic Sell Through), Broadband and other IP platforms and affiliates.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

1. Traffic incoming schedules and meta data from business units and format as per CableLabs industry and specific affiliate and platform specifications
2. Prepare meta data and all required documentation and deliver to external Affiliates and Transmission Companies
3. Ingest all meta data and schedule information into department’s Asset Management System
4. QC all content deliverables prior to delivery from Advanced Platform group and in live status mode utilizing all available means (Rentrak, SlingBox, etc)
5. Assist in the implementation of the Meta Data Schedule Team’s responsibility in disseminating reports, data and other information both internally and externally as needed
6. Assist Meta Data Schedule Team’s efforts in supporting Affiliate and Business Unit Marketing groups in Advanced Platform related promotions and initiatives
7. Participates in special projects and performs other duties as assigned.

SCOPE

This position contributes to assuring all contract obligations are met as to the distribution of advanced platform programming to MSO, Affiliates and other business partners. In addition, this position contributes to maximizing efficiencies of the workflow procedures of the Advanced Platform group resulting in reducing both time and direct expenses and also assuring all transactional and ad sale revenue potentials are maximized.

Library Web Systems at the University of Michigan Library seeks a talented and enthusiastic Interface Developer to work on the front end of the library’s Drupal-powered website, VuFind-powered library catalog (Mirlyn), Omeka online exhibit management system, and other library web interfaces. The ideal candidate will have a passion for developing accessible interfaces to web resources, bring a clear sense of design to the job, collaborate with colleagues across the library, and have strong problem-solving skills.

The Interface Developer will work with a team of developers in Web Systems, developers in other areas of Library Information Technology, and the User Experience department staff to bring improvements to accessibility and user experience to the library’s website.

Library Web Systems manages the University of Michigan Library’s web site, the online presence for one of the largest research libraries in the world. The U-M Library’s technology unit designs, develops, and supports the library’s primary web interfaces – including multiple websites, access systems, search apps, and mobile interfaces. These interfaces provide access to over 10 million physical and digital resources to more than 2 million users a month.

The User Experience (UX) Department at the University of Michigan Library is seeking a Web Content Strategist to support a multi-year initiative to redesign the library’s web presence, and to take the lead on developing and managing an overall web content strategy.

Working under the direction of the Head of the UX Department, the Web Content Strategist will collaborate closely with UX, the Communications Department, and the Web Committee, as well as library content creators, and stakeholders. The ideal candidate will have a passion for understanding users, strong creative and problem solving skills, and be invested in improving the library website user experience.

About the UX Department: the UX Department is responsible for the design, user research, and content strategy of the library’s primary public interfaces – including multiple websites, access systems, search apps, and mobile interfaces. These interfaces provide access to over 10 million physical and digital resources to more than 2 million users a month.
